Chengdu Celebrates Artistry at 2nd Golden Panda Awards
The 2nd Golden Panda Awards took place on September 12 and 13, 2025, in Chengdu, China, showcasing a remarkable celebration of global film and television artistry. Organized by the China Federation of Literary and Art Circles and the People’s Government of Sichuan Province, this prestigious event aims to foster cultural exchange and promote shared human values through the medium of film and television.
This year’s awards, held under the theme “Where Light Meets Shadow, Beauty Unveiled,” highlighted the importance of storytelling in bridging cultural divides. The event included a diverse array of films, television dramas, documentaries, and animations, recognizing excellence across these four major categories. The focus was on selecting outstanding productions that exemplify high artistic standards and humanistic values.
The Golden Panda Awards have quickly gained recognition for their professionalism and international reach, attracting participation from filmmakers and creators around the world. The event not only awarded 27 distinguished projects but also facilitated meaningful dialogue among different civilizations, affirming the role of art in shaping a global cultural landscape.
